View file my_music/edit_kat_prew.php

File size: 3.78Kb
<?
/*
Автор скрипта: Simptom
Сайт поддержки: http://y-monitora.com
Запрещено распространять скрипт в любом виде и под любым предлогом!
*/
define("H", $_SERVER["DOCUMENT_ROOT"].'/');
include_once H.'sys/inc/start.php';
include_once H.'sys/inc/compress.php';
include_once H.'sys/inc/sess.php';
include_once H.'sys/inc/settings.php';
include_once H.'sys/inc/db_connect.php';
include_once H.'sys/inc/ipua.php';
include_once H.'sys/inc/fnc.php';
include_once H.'sys/inc/user.php';
if (!isset($user))
{
header("Location: /index.php");
exit;
}
if (isset($_GET['id']))
{
$it=intval($_GET['id']);
$kat=mysql_fetch_assoc(mysql_query("SELECT * FROM `my_music_kat` WHERE `id` = '".$it."' LIMIT 1"));
$ank=mysql_fetch_assoc(mysql_query("SELECT * FROM `user` WHERE `id` = '".$kat['id_user']."' LIMIT 1"));
}
if (!isset($_GET['id']) || !isset($kat) || $kat['id']<=0 || ($user['id']!=$ank['id'] && $user['level']<=3))
{
$set['title']="Музыка - Ошибка";
include_once H.'sys/inc/thead.php';
title();
aut();
echo "<div class='err'>";
echo "Ошибка!";
echo "</div>";
include_once H.'sys/inc/tfoot.php';
exit;
}
$set['title']="Музыка - Сменить обложку";
include_once H.'sys/inc/thead.php';
title();
aut();
include_once H.'simptom/my_music/inc/inc.php';
if (isset($_GET['dell']) && is_file(H."simptom/my_music/prev_album/".$kat['id'].".jpg"))
{
unlink(H."simptom/my_music/prev_album/".$kat['id'].".jpg");
header("Location: /my_music/edit_kat_prew.php?id=".$kat['id']."");
exit;
}
if (isset($_POST['simptom']))
{
if (isset($_FILES['filik_ob']) && isset($_FILES['filik_ob']['tmp_name']) && ((preg_match('#\.jpe?g$#i',$_FILES['filik_ob']['name']) && $imgc=@imagecreatefromjpeg($_FILES['filik_ob']['tmp_name'])) || (preg_match('#\.gif$#i',$_FILES['filik_ob']['name']) && $imgc=@imagecreatefromgif($_FILES['filik_ob']['tmp_name'])) || (preg_match('#\.png$#i',$_FILES['filik_ob']['name']) && $imgc=@imagecreatefrompng($_FILES['filik_ob']['tmp_name']))))
{
if (is_file(H."simptom/my_music/prev_album/".$kat['id'].".jpg"))
{
unlink(H."simptom/my_music/prev_album/".$kat['id'].".jpg");
}
imagejpeg($imgc,H."simptom/my_music/prev_album/".$kat['id'].".jpg",100);
chmod(H."simptom/my_music/prev_album/".$kat['id'].".jpg",0777);
msg("Обложка успешно заменена!");
}else{
$err="Выберите изображение!";
}
}
err();
echo "<div class='my_music_51'>";
echo "<form class='my_music_52' method='post' enctype='multipart/form-data' name='message' action='/my_music/edit_kat_prew.php?id=".$kat['id']."'>";
echo "<div class='my_music_53'>";
echo "<div class='my_music_54'>";
echo "<div class='my_music_106'>";
if (is_file(H."simptom/my_music/prev_album/".$kat['id'].".jpg"))
{
echo "<img class='my_music_107' src='".simptom_my_music_prev_album($kat['id'])."' alt='Simptom'><br />";
echo "<img class='my_music_18' src='/simptom/my_music/dell.png' alt='Simptom'> ";
echo "<a href='/my_music/edit_kat_prew.php?id=".$kat['id']."&amp;dell'>Удалить</a>";
}else{
echo "<img class='my_music_107' src='/simptom/my_music/prev_album.png' alt='Simptom'><br />";
}
echo "</div>";
echo "<input class='my_music_55' name='filik_ob' type='file' /><br />";
echo "</div>";
echo "</div>";
echo "<input class='my_music_56' type='submit' name='simptom' value='Продолжить' />";
echo "</form>";
echo "</div>";
echo "<a class='my_music' href='/my_music/kat.php?id=".$kat['id']."'>";
echo "<span class='my_music_2'>";
echo "<img class='my_music_3' src='/simptom/my_music/back.png' alt='Simptom'> ";
echo "<span class='my_music_4'>";
echo "".stripcslashes(htmlspecialchars($kat['name']))."";
echo "</span>";
echo "</span>";
echo "</a>";
include_once H.'sys/inc/tfoot.php';
?>